Capital improvement projects are not covered as part of the monthly <br /> operation and maintenance fee and will be billed separately to the County. <br /> i. Extraordinary maintenance; Extraordinary maintenance is defined as costs <br /> that are more than $1,000 per incident. Pump repairs and main breaks are <br /> examples of events that could be "extraordinary maintenance". Contractor <br /> will need either written or oral authorization by the County before <br /> proceeding with any extraordinary maintenance except in cases which in <br /> the Contractor's judgment repairs are necessary to safeguard the public or <br /> the County. The Contractor will notify the County as soon as practical that <br /> such a repair was required. <br /> Exhibit B <br /> Page 3 of 6 <br />
